If a material managed in project stock is to be procured from another plant using a cross-company-code stock transport order, the indicator must be set to 2 (collective requirements) in the issuing plant because, in this specific context, individual project stock management is not possible in both plants.

    Hi Rajesh,
    when ur creating STO with UB doc type, then you have to maintain material in both the plants.
    Regarding the error which is comming for you, you have to check the settings at
    SPRO- IMG- MM-Purchasing-Set up stock transport order- Assign delivery type & Checking rule
    here for document type UB and your supplying plant-XXXX select nothing for Dlv type(delivery type) and chr - 01 and after this save.
    After this you create STO as you are doing and see what the system is prompting.

    Hi Gar,
    Usually when there is a crossing of borders, it is a movement between 2 different companies code, therefore the intercompany purchase is the usual flow.
    If you mean that the flow is between plants of the same company code between different countries, maybe you are talking about "Plants abroad" functionality.
    http://help.sap.com/saphelp_45b/helpdata/en/34/60b1a0ae724effe10000009b38f91f/content.htm
    Previously, the plants of a company code had to belong to the country of that company code.
    As of Release 4.0A, it is possible to deviate from this rule for European company codes with European plants.
    I never had to use this functionality at a customer site, but that sounds like your requirement
    Also allows internal billing document for intrastat reporting, so feel free to evaluate!

    I don't think so.
    You need to transfer the production forecast as demand plan in the production plant. Have a MTS planning strategy (like 10), then manufacturing is triggered by this demand plan, and goods are stocked in the production plant, waiting for the pull call from the sales plant.
    Don't forget to take care of the consumption of demand with STO (I think there's a note on this).

    Hi Anand,
    Check whether you have created Masters for the Supplying & Vendor Plants.
    If you have already created your supplying Plant as a Vendor using the Plant refernce.
    Then maintain your Receiving Plant Customer Master no: in your Supplying Plant Vendor master
    control data - Customer Field.
    Also check your Customer master Receiving Plant Control Data whether your Supplying Plant Vendor no: is there after you have made the above assignment.

    Business partner
    ●     Vendor master u2013 supplying plant
    Create the vendor for the purchasing organization of the receiving plant.
    Assign the vendor to the supplying plant in the vendor master record.
    From the menu, choose Logistics ® Materials Management ® Purchasing ® Master Data ® Vendor ® Purchasing ® Change (Current). Go to the Purchasing View and choose Extras ® Additional Purchasing Data.
    ●     Customer master u2013 receiving plant
    Create a customer master record for the receiving plant. From this, both the address and the data that is relevant for shipping point determination, such as transportation zone and shipping condition are taken.
    From the menu, choose Logistics ® Sales and Distribution ® Master Data ® Business Partner ® Customer ® Create.

    *The exact error message is as follows;
    "  No commitment item entered in item 00001 plant < >
       Message no. FI311
    Diagnosis
    The posted document contains at least one company code in which Funds Management, Cash Budget Management, or Project Cash Management is active. Therefore you must enter a commitment item in all involved company codes.
    Procedure
    Enter a commitment item.
    If you cannot enter a commitment item, check with your system administrator that your account assignment derivation is adjusted so that the system can automatically derive a commitment item from another account assignment, or from the G/L or cost element.   "
